Company Description The Sunrise Student Investment Club at IIM Visakhapatnam is a data-driven in-house investment team that conducts research on live market data across multiple time frames using both quantitative and qualitative models. The club’s members, including junior and senior fund managers, actively manage a portfolio of funds and share insights through sector and equity analyst reports, as well as guest lectures from industry professionals. Sunrise Investment Club focuses on deepening the IIM Visakhapatnam community’s understanding of financial markets, asset markets, and personal finance by fostering a strong investment education culture. It offers students real-time exposure to investment decision-making and enables them to apply PGP quantitative learnings to enhance their corporate readiness and personal financial management. Knowledge transfer is supported through mentoring by Senior Fund Managers and faculty guidance, giving students hands-on experience in investment management.
Role Description As a full-time Member of Sunrise Investment Club, IIM Visakhapatnam, located on-site in Mumbai, you will participate in end-to-end investment research and portfolio management activities. On a day-to-day basis, you will analyze live market data, build and refine quantitative and qualitative models, and contribute to sector and equity research reports. You will collaborate with junior and senior fund managers to evaluate investment opportunities, track portfolio performance, and support strategy discussions. The role also involves preparing research presentations, assisting in organizing guest lectures, and engaging in knowledge-sharing sessions with the IIM Visakhapatnam community. Members are expected to stay updated on market developments, adhere to research standards, and actively contribute to a culture of rigorous, ethical investing.
Qualifications
Candidates should possess strong analytical and quantitative skills, including comfort with financial data analysis, basic statistics, and spreadsheet-based modeling.
Candidates should possess foundational knowledge of financial markets, investment instruments, and portfolio management concepts.
Candidates should possess solid research and writing abilities to produce clear, structured sector and equity reports and concise investment theses.
Candidates should possess effective communication and collaboration skills to work within a team of fund managers and present findings to diverse audiences.
Candidates should possess high attention to detail, ethical judgment, and the ability to follow disciplined research and investment processes.
Beneficial qualifications include enrollment in a management program (such as PGP), familiarity with valuation techniques (DCF, multiples), and interest in personal finance and long-term investing.
Experience with basic programming or data tools (e.g., Excel, Python, R, or financial databases) and prior participation in finance or investment-related clubs or competitions is an advantage.
